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06636186 7777 9936430460 52594
6766 2473070221 589026
6766 2473070221 589026
46660 66 55 95232516 37355
All about undefined
Interested in learning more?
6766 2473070221 589026
46660 66 55 95232516 37355
See more
35439 25828186018
93221 03 24185564997
See more
653463377 67006
5368130 57494587 3738958151
See more